The cost of pursuing a Bachelor of Commerce (B.Com) at Janki Devi Memorial College, Delhi University (DU), varies based on the specialization. The fees for B.Com range from 10,695 INR to 61,370 INR yearly, with an average of 36,032 INR yearly. Additionally, for B.Com (Hons.), the fees are 10,695 INR yearly. Admission to the B.Com programme at Janki Devi Memorial College is based on the Common University Entrance Test (CUET) and meeting specific eligibility criteria, including a minimum aggregate score of 85% in 10+2 education from a recognised board or its equivalent, with English and Mathematics/Business Mathematics as compulsory subj

The cutoff marks required for B.Com at Janki Devi Memorial College, Delhi University (DU), can vary from year to year based on various factors. In the past, the cutoff percentages for B.Com at Janki Devi Memorial College have been as follows:

General Category: 95.5% in 2022

OBC: 91.5% in 2022

SC: 88.5% in 2022

ST: 86.5% in 2022

PwD: 86.5% in 2022

EWS: 95.75% in 2022

Kashmiri Migrants: 88.5% in 2022

Hi.Eligibility criteria for B.A programme offered by Sri Guru Nanak Dev Khalsa College University of Delhi:

Candidate must have passed 10+2 with any one Language from List A with any two subjects from List B1 and any one subject from either List B1 or List B2 or Any one language from List A with any one subject from either List B1 or List B2 and SECTION III of CUET (General Test) from any recognised Board/Council.
